Hunter Douglas expects court decision 14 July 2005 at 14.00 hoursRotterdam, 6 July 2005 - Hunter Douglas and Bergson have filed briefs in the summary judgement proceedings brought by certain minority shareholders of Hunter Douglas. The plaintiffs seek, amongst other things, to enjoin Hunter Douglas and Bergson from consummating the tender offer by Bergson for 10,500,000 common shares of Hunter Douglas.

During today's hearing, the court indicated that it expects to render a decision by Thursday 14 July 2005 at 14.00 hours. Accordingly, Hunter Douglas will request suspension of trading in its shares on 14 July 2005 commencing 13.00 hours. Further announcements will follow after the court's decision has been announced.
